Saronic's Aug. 5 Series D closed at a $9.25B valuation the same week a Brownsville shipyard went public. The All In hosts frame it as a 230 to 1 race.
Brownsville, Texas will host a 4,000-acre shipyard called "Port Alpha" that Saronic says will create roughly 10,000 jobs, according to show notes from the Aug. 5, 2026 All-In episode featuring the company's founders. The same day, the autonomous-vessel startup closed a $1.75 billion Series D at a $9.25 billion valuation, led by Kleiner Perkins, with Advent International, Bessemer Venture Partners, DFJ Growth, and BAM Elevate joining as new investors. Read together, the two events sketch a single bet: that the U.S. can out-volume China not with $3 billion destroyers but with fleets of small, cheap, unmanned boats.

The Navy is already buying into the underlying logic. Saronic was awarded a $392 million production contract for its 24-foot Corsair autonomous surface vessels in December 2025, with roughly $200 million obligated at award, and the service has said it wants half of the surface fleet to be unmanned, according to Fast Company's April 2026 profile of the company.
The Corsair is a 24-foot surface boat, smaller than a city bus. The Marauder is a 180-foot autonomous vessel that advanced to U.S. Navy MUSV (Medium Unmanned Surface Vessel) at-sea testing in June 2026, building on the same contract line. The point is not that any one of these boats is a warship. The point is that hundreds of them, acting in concert, can do the work of a crewed frigate at a fraction of the unit cost, and that an adversary has to defend against all of them, not just the one it can see on radar. Saronic already operates a shipyard in Franklin, Louisiana, scaling its fleet, and the company's vessels page lists the range from the small Spyglass and Cutlass up to the Marauder. In the Series D release, CEO Dino Mavrookas framed the broader build-out as U.S. shipbuilding capacity on a timeline not seen since World War II.
The friction is the contracting model that built the last fleet. The All-In episode argues that cost-plus contracting, the standard Navy deal structure that reimburses a contractor's costs plus a fixed percentage fee, keeps shipbuilding slow and expensive, and that only about 1% of the relevant Navy budget actually reaches autonomous programs. Both claims are podcast-side framing on the episode, not independently sourced in the assignment. The structural point survives: if the binding constraint on U.S. naval power is not ship design but shipyard throughput and contracting reform, then a Brownsville shipyard and a Series D round are the right variables to watch, but they are not yet the right ones to declare a win. The next milestones to watch are whether Port Alpha breaks ground on the timeline Saronic has set, and whether the Corsair and Marauder programs move from test articles into serial production under fixed-price rather than cost-plus terms.
